What is Slopping Out in Prisons?

Slopping out is a degrading practice in prisons. It means that prisoners are required to wait in queues to use toilets. These can range from two hours to as long as eight hours. Some prisoners also have to dispose of their human waste in buckets or through cell windows.

It is thought that slopping out in prisons is not a rare practice. However, it has been condemned by the European Committee for the Prevention of Torture, which equates slopping out with overcrowding.

The prison service claims that things are gradually improving. In fact, there is no definitive data on how many prisoners still use pots overnight. But one report has estimated that the number of female offenders in custody has risen by 29% in the last two years.

Some prisons, including Long Lartin and HMP Coldingley, have been criticised for their night sanitation system. The Independent Monitoring Board (IMB) has found that five blocks at Coldingley still slop out.

One of the reasons that sloping out in prisons is so prevalent is the lack of integral sanitation. Cells are often too small to accommodate a toilet and, without adequate cleaning materials, are invariably dirty.

What are the 8S Cultural Appropriation?

Sagging pants are an old style of clothing worn by Black people that primarily originates in the American prison system. The sagging style was repopularized by hip hop culture in the ’90s and eventually became a symbol of black youth culture.

Its cultural appropriation has been a contentious issue. High-fashion brands such as Gucci, Burberry, and Prada have faced backlash for appropriating symbols from minority cultures. In recent years, several cities in the United States have passed laws banning sagging. But the debate has also been used as a means of examining the relationship between prejudice and privilege.

While sagging has been associated with hip hop culture and Black youth, it has also been used as a symbol of racism. A saggy-pantaloons law was recently repealed in Shreveport, Louisiana, after an ACLU of Louisiana legal director argued that the city’s law was a violation of the First and Fourteenth Amendments.

One example of the sagging style’s appropriation is Balenciaga sweatpants. These “trompe l’oeil” (translated as ‘trick of the eye’) pants appear to have an over-the-waistband boxer brief peeking out. However, the sweatpants have been criticized for being racist and a blatant ripoff of Black culture.
